The educational program “Public Management and Administration” (specialty D4 Public Management and Administration) is aimed at training doctors of philosophy who are able to conduct independent scientific research, produce new ideas and solve complex problems in the field of public management, administration, public policy, local self-government and the development of public institutions.

You will receive modern knowledge in the methodology of scientific research, theory and practice of public management, public policy analysis, strategic management of territorial development, digital governance, academic writing, scientific and pedagogical activity, quantitative and qualitative research methods.

The peculiarity of the program lies in the combination of scientific, managerial, analytical and practice-oriented training of postgraduate students. It is aimed not only at in-depth study of public management and administration, but also at developing the ability to conduct their own research, create new knowledge and develop management solutions for the development of the public sector.

The program allows you to explore current issues of public policy, local government, public administration, institutional development, change management, interaction between government, business and civil society.

Yes. The educational program is adapted to the European Qualifications Framework and meets the general requirements of the European Association for Quality Assurance in Higher Education (ENQA). This ensures that the training of students complies with modern European approaches to the quality of education.

The educational program “Public Management and Administration” is implemented in Ukrainian and English. This gives postgraduate students the opportunity to develop professional competencies not only in the Ukrainian but also in the international educational environment.

The educational program “Public Management and Administration” is available in full-time, part-time, and distance learning formats. This allows you to choose a convenient format for obtaining education according to your own needs and capabilities.

The volume of the educational program based on complete general secondary education is 60 ECTS credits. The duration of study is 4 years.

Postgraduate students of the educational program “Public Management and Administration” master the methodology of scientific research, modern theories of public management, tools for analyzing public policy, approaches to evaluating management decisions and mechanisms for developing public institutions.

The training covers general and professional educational components, the formation of an individual educational trajectory, the preparation of a dissertation research, the publication of scientific results, participation in conferences, seminars, scientific projects and professional discussions.

Postgraduate students have the opportunity to conduct and test the results of their own research on the basis of the Laboratory of Socio-Economic Research of Sumy State University, the Laboratory of Ideas, scientific conferences of the Institute of Economics and Management, the scientific and practical Internet conference of the Department of Management “Modern Management and Economic Development”, as well as publish research results in scientific publications of the Institute of Economics and Management and the repository of Sumy State University.

The program provides for international academic mobility, participation in international research and educational initiatives, interaction with foreign universities, and the possibility of dual scientific supervision of dissertations with the participation of foreign scientists. Among the strengths of the program are also noted international cooperation with partner universities from Poland, France, the USA, the UK and other countries.
